Fritzing: An Open-Source Electronics Design Software
Fritzing is an innovative open-source software application designed for electronics enthusiasts, engineers, and educators. It allows users to create and document electronic circuit designs with ease, bridging the gap between hardware and software. Fritzing is particularly popular among hobbyists and makers who want to visualize and share their electronic projects.
History
Fritzing was born out of a project initiated by students at the University of Applied Sciences in Potsdam, Germany, in 2006. The primary goal was to create a tool that would help people document their electronic designs and share them with others. The first official release of Fritzing came out in 2010, and since then, it has grown into a robust community-driven platform with contributions from users worldwide. The software is developed and maintained by a dedicated team, and it has been funded by various grants and donations.
Features
Fritzing offers a variety of features that make it a powerful tool for electronic design:
- Breadboard View: Users can visually create circuits using a breadboard layout, making it easy to prototype circuits before moving to PCB designs.
- Schematic View: Fritzing allows users to generate and edit schematic diagrams, providing a clear representation of the circuit connections.
- PCB Layout: Users can design printed circuit boards (PCBs) with Fritzing, including the ability to route traces, place components, and prepare designs for manufacturing.
- Component Library: Fritzing has an extensive library of components, including resistors, capacitors, microcontrollers, and sensors. Users can also create custom components and share them with the community.
- Export Options: The software supports exporting designs in various formats, making it easy to share projects or send designs to manufacturers.
- Community Sharing: Fritzing includes a built-in feature to share projects with the Fritzing community, allowing users to showcase their designs and discover others’ work.
Common Use Cases
Fritzing is utilized in various contexts, including:
- Education: Many educators use Fritzing as a teaching tool in electronics and robotics courses, helping students learn circuit design and prototyping concepts.
- Prototyping: Hobbyists and makers often use Fritzing for quick prototyping of electronic projects, enabling them to visualize their designs on breadboards and PCBs before physical assembly.
- Documentation: Fritzing is an excellent tool for documenting electronics projects, ensuring that designs can be easily followed and replicated.
- Open-source Projects: Many open-source hardware projects utilize Fritzing files, allowing contributors to collaborate and improve upon each other’s designs.
